WebPerform the following steps to install the RDS role on a server running Windows Server Core.. 1. Type Start PowerShell in the Command Prompt window to start Windows PowerShell.. 2. Type Install-WindowsFeature Remote-Desktop-Services and press Enter to install the RDS role.. WebJul 6, 2024 · First line retrieves path to RDS connection. By default, it is “RDP-tcp”. Specify custom RDS connection name if non-default connection must be configured. In the second line, specify a TLS certificate SHA1 thumbprint. It must be exactly 40 hexadecimal character long string without spaces and control characters. WebOct 3, 2024 · Click the Server Manager menu and select Add Roles and Features -> Remote Desktop Services installation -> Standard deployment –> Session-based deployment. Quick Start mode is used to deploy all RDS roles on a single server. An RDS farm can have only one server running all RDS roles (RD Session Host, RD Web Access, and RD Connection broker).
